DETERMINED to have a crime-free Yuletide, the Delta State Police Command has arrested a suspected armed robber, Mr. Lucky Nwadi of Onicha-Ugbo, Aniocha Local North Council of the state.
The Command’s Spokesperson, Celestina Kalu, who disclosed this in Asaba yesterday, said that on Tuesday, December 22, 2015, operatives from the Special Anti-Robbery Squad (SARS) in Asaba while acting on a tip-off arrested the suspect at Otulu in Aniocha Local Council.
Kalu said that items recovered from Nwadi included one locally-made pistol, one expended/one live cartridge and one unregistered Skygo motorcycle.
Also on Christmas eve, an anti-robbery patrol team from ‘A’ Division along Ginuwa Road by Okere junction sighted a tricycle with four occupants but that the rider of the tricycle immediately zoomed off in a suspicious manner.
According to her, the patrol team gave the hoodlums a hot chase, forcing the criminals to abandon the tricycle and escaped.
She said that items recovered from the fleeing bandit included the ill-fated tricycle, a black school bag containing two locally-made cut-to-size guns and three live cartridges.
Kalu, a Deputy Superintendent of Police, said that efforts to track down the fleeing miscreants have been intensified, adding that investigations in both cases are still on.
